J.D. Byrider announced a major change in leadership on Tuesday as the franchise network of buy-here, pay-here dealerships recently appointed Craig Peters as chief executive officer, replacing Steve Wedding, who served the company for 25 years.

The company indicated Wedding will support the transition as an advisor to the J.D. Byrider board of directors.

Most recently serving as chief operations and technology officer of Barclaycard US, a top-10 U.S. card issuer and division of Barclays, Peters was responsible for delivering a new technology platform to support the launch of a new consumer lending business while driving efficiencies and improving quality at the company.

Peters brings more than 20 years of leadership experience in consumer finance to J.D. Byrider with a broad base of global experience across operations, collections, risk management and technology. He has successfully transformed many businesses and operations during his tenure at HSBC, Capital One and Barclays.

“We are thrilled to bring someone with Craig’s experience and track record to J.D. Byrider,” J.D. Byrider executive chairman Aaron Tankersley said.

“Craig’s leadership will be instrumental in the continued development of new services and systems for our current franchisees, as well as the successful growth of additional company-owned and franchised locations,” Tankersley went on to say.
